Preheat oven to 350F degrees. Coat a pie plate or 8x8 baking dish with nonstick cooking spray.
In a mixing bowl, whisk the flours, baking soda, baking powder, sugar and salt.
In a separate bowl, stir buttermilk, egg and melted butter together.
Make a well in the center of the bowl of flour mixture. Pour the buttermilk into the well. Use your hands to work the flour into the buttermilk until a loose dough forms.
Dump the dough onto a work surface and bring the dough together into a ball. Place the dough ball into the prepared baking dish and flatten it slightly into a disc shape.
Use a sharp knife to score the dough. Brush the top of the loaf with extra buttermilk.
Bake for 50 minutes, until the exterior is golden brown. Cool in the baking dish for 5-10 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ack until the bread reaches room temperature.
